How to fill out the FL Form 83045 online

The FL Form 83045 is essential for registering a street rod, custom vehicle, horseless carriage, or antique vehicle in Florida. This guide provides a step-by-step process to assist users in completing the form online with clarity and support.

Follow the steps to fill out the FL Form 83045 online successfully.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
  2. Enter your name in the 'Name of Applicant' field, along with your street address, city, state, and zip code in the designated sections.
  3. Fill in your email address and provide your date of birth and Florida Driver License Number or FEID Number in the corresponding fields.
  4. Provide details about your vehicle, including the year, make, body type, weight, color, engine or ID number, and title number. Additionally, include any previous license plate number if applicable.
  5. Select the appropriate certification from the options provided based on the type of vehicle you are registering. Ensure that you understand the definitions and requirements for a street rod, custom vehicle, horseless carriage, or antique.
  6. Sign the form in the designated area, certifying that all information provided is true and correct.
  7. Review your completed form for accuracy. Once satisfied, you can save the changes, download, print, or share the form as needed.
